#17d946 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#17d946 is composed of 9% red, 85.1% green and 27.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 67.7% yellow and 14.9% black. It has a hue angle of 134.5 degrees, a saturation of 80.8% and a lightness of 47.1%. #17d946 color hex could be obtained by blending #2eff8c with #00b300. Closest websafe color is: #00cc33.

#17d946 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#17d946 has RGB values of R:23, G:217, B:70 and CMYK values of C:0.89, M:0, Y:0.68,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 1562950.

Shades and Tints of #17d946
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000401 is the darkest color, while #f1fef4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#17d946
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#737d76 is the less saturated color, while #05eb3c is the most saturated one.
